Description

19th-century rosewood open bookcase, the rectangular well-figured top with raised gallery, above a moulded frieze supported on capped columns. Enclosing the fixed shelved interior, all raised on a plinth base.

Dimensions

Height 43 Inches

Width 37.5 Inches

Depth 15 Inches

A 19th-century open bookcase is a freestanding wooden storage unit constructed without glass or wooden doors, featuring open horizontal shelves, a solid plinth base, and often decorative top galleries or side pilasters.

Cabinetmakers during this period predominantly used dense, durable hardwoods such as rosewood, mahogany, oak, and walnut, often finished with natural oil or shellac polish.

Authentic 19th-century rosewood exhibits distinct dark purplish-brown grain streaks, heavy dense timber weight, hand-cut joinery on backboards or internal framing, and natural wear around the base and shelf edges.

An antique open bookcase can be styled alongside contemporary ceramics, framed prints, and folded textiles to contrast rich dark timber tones while providing functional storage.

Keep the wood away from direct heat sources and sunlight to prevent drying or fading, and clean regularly with a dry cloth before applying a natural beeswax polish along the direction of the grain.
